How much do injection molding processor j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 10, 2026, the average hourly pay for injection molding processor in Baltimore, MD is $26.48,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$23.89 and $28.65 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is an injection molding processor?

Injection Molding Processors are skilled technicians responsible for setting up, operating, and troubleshooting injection molding machines used to produce plastic parts. They monitor the molding process, adjust machine settings for quality and efficiency, and ensure products meet specifications. Their duties often include performing routine maintenance, changing molds, and addressing any production issues that arise. Injection Molding Processors play a key role in manufacturing industries that rely on high-quality plastic components.

What skills and qualifications are needed to thrive as an injection molding processor?

To thrive as an Injection Molding Processor, you need a solid understanding of plastics processing, machine operation, troubleshooting techniques, and often a high school diploma or technical certification. Familiarity with injection molding machines, quality control systems, and process monitoring software is typically required. Attention to detail, problem-solving skills, and effective communication help processors respond quickly to production issues and work well with teams. These skills ensure efficient, high-quality manufacturing and minimize downtime or defects in a demanding production environment.

What are some common challenges faced by injection molding processors, and how can they be addressed?

Injection Molding Processors often face challenges such as maintaining product quality, troubleshooting machine malfunctions, and minimizing production downtime. These issues can be addressed by regularly monitoring process parameters, conducting routine maintenance, and staying proactive with mold and material inspections. Collaboration with maintenance teams and quality control specialists is critical to quickly resolve issues and ensure consistent output. Staying updated with best practices and process optimization techniques also helps processors excel in their role.

What is the difference between Injection Molding Processor vs Injection Molding Technician?

AspectInjection Molding ProcessorInjection Molding Technician
C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; some roles may require technical certificationsHigh school diploma; technical training or certifications often preferred
Work EnvironmentManufacturing plants, operating injection molding machinesManufacturing settings, assisting with machine setup and troubleshooting
Job FocusSetting up, operating, and monitoring injection molding machinesMaintaining, troubleshooting, and repairing injection molding equipment

The Injection Molding Processor primarily focuses on running and controlling injection molding machines to produce parts, while the Injection Molding Technician supports machine maintenance and troubleshooting. Both roles require technical knowledge and work in similar manufacturing environments, but their responsibilities differ in scope and focus.

Is injection molding a hard job?

Injection molding processing is a skilled manufacturing job that requires attention to detail, knowledge of machinery, and safety procedures. It can be physically demanding and often involves working with hot equipment and materials, but with proper training and experience, it becomes manageable. Certifications and understanding of quality control are also important for success in this role.

Job Summary:
We are seeking a highly experienced Sr. Staff Engineer, Molding to provide expert technical leadership and strategic direction for our molding operations, ensuring optimal performance, quality, and innovation in the development and manufacturing of critical life science products.
Job Responsibilities:

  • Lead the design, development, and optimization of complex injection molding processes, tools, and equipment for high-volume, high-precision medical devices and diagnostic components. Serve as the primary technical expert for all molding-related activities, including material selection, process parameter development, mold design review, and troubleshooting of molding defects.

  • Drive continuous improvement initiatives in molding operations, implementing advanced manufacturing techniques, automation, and lean principles to enhance efficiency, reduce costs, and improve product quality.

  • Collaborate cross-functionally with R&D, Quality, Manufacturing, and Supply Chain teams to ensure seamless integration of molding processes into new product introductions and existing product lines.

  • Mentor and provide technical guidance to junior engineers and technicians, fostering a culture of technical excellence and innovation within the molding department.

  • Develop and implement robust process validation strategies (IQ, OQ, PQ) for molding processes, ensuring compliance with FDA, ISO, and other relevant regulatory standards.

  • Evaluate and recommend new molding technologies, materials, and equipment to enhance capabilities and maintain a competitive edge.

  • Conduct root cause analysis of molding failures and implement effective corrective and preventive actions.

  • Manage and prioritize multiple projects, ensuring timely delivery within budget and scope.


Job Qualifications:

  • Bachelor's degree in Mechanical Engineering, Materials Science, Polymer Engineering, or a related technical field. Master's or Ph.D. preferred.

  • 10+ years of progressive experience in injection molding engineering within the medical device, pharmaceutical, or other highly regulated industries.

  • Demonstrated expertise in mold design, polymer science, process optimization, and scientific molding principles.

  • Extensive experience with various thermoplastic and thermoset materials used in life science applications.

  • Proficiency in DFM, DFA, statistical process control (SPC), and design of experiments (DOE).

  • Strong understanding of regulatory requirements (e.g., FDA 21 CFR Part 820, ISO 13485) applicable to medical device manufacturing.

  • Experience with CAD software (e.g., SolidWorks, Creo) and mold flow simulation software (e.g., Moldflow, Sigmasoft).

  • Proven ability to lead complex technical projects and mentor engineering teams.

  • Excellent problem-solving, analytical, and communication skills.
